Finland is about to bury spent nuclear gasoline on the earth’s first geological tomb, the place it will likely be saved for 100,000 years.
The pioneering venture was welcomed as each a watershed second for the long-term sustainability of nuclear energy and a “mannequin for the entire world”.
Sooner or later both subsequent yr or early 2026, the extremely radioactive spent nuclear gasoline shall be packed into watertight canisters and deposited in bedrock greater than 400 meters beneath the forests of southwestern Finland.
The sturdy copper packing containers shall be insulated, separated from people, and stored underground for 1000’s of years.
“Onkalo”, which is the trademark of the long-term burial facility, is the Finnish phrase for a small cave or pit. It is an apt identify for the repository, which sits atop a maze of tunnels and sits subsequent to a few nuclear reactors on the island of Olkiluoto, roughly 240 kilometers from the capital Helsinki.

Established in 1995, Posiva is charged with the duty of dealing with the ultimate disposal of spent nuclear gasoline rods at Onkalo. The Finnish firm is collectively owned by nuclear energy firm TVO and utility Fortum.
“Basically, the Onkalo venture is that we’re constructing an encapsulation plant and a spent gasoline disposal facility. And it isn’t non permanent, it is without end,” Pasi Tuohimaa, Posiva’s head of communications, advised CNBC by way of video convention.

The position of nuclear power
The Onkalo venture has ignited a debate about whether or not one can assure the long-term security of spent nuclear waste and the extent to which nuclear power needs to be used within the struggle in opposition to climate crisis.
Nuclear energy presently supplies about 9% of the world’s electrical energy, according to to the World Nuclear Affiliation.
As a result of it’s low in carbon, defenders they argue that nuclear energy has the potential to play a major position in serving to international locations generate electrical energy whereas lowering emissions and lowering their dependence on fossil fuels.
Some environmental teams, nonetheless say the nuclear trade is an costly and dangerous distraction to cheaper and cleaner alternate options.

“Mannequin for the entire world”
The Onkalo venture is based utilizing the so-called “KBS-3” methodology developed by the Swedish Nuclear Gasoline and Waste Administration Firm, which is engaged on what could possibly be the world’s second remaining repository.
KBS-3 relies on a multi-barrier principlethe place a number of engineering limitations search to make sure the long-term security of spent nuclear gasoline. In observe, which means that if one of many limitations fails, the isolation of the radioactive waste just isn’t compromised.
